"Even My Surgeon Has No Explanation": the Tumbler Axel Duriez, Broke by Two Ruptures of the Achilles Tendon

Summary by L'ÉQUIPE
The silver medallist at the World Games and bronze medallist at the World Championships in 2022, the tumbler Axel Duriez suffered two successive breaks in the Achille tendon, in 2023 and 2024. A black series that now obliges him to put an end to his career at the age of 20 only.
